Default G3- Strange Behavior

I have a G3 that will take picture ok but when I go to the Mode lever to view my images the photos start previewing but very rapidly. If I try to use the Menu button, the date/time menu appears and won't let me set the time or date. I replaced the clock battery and it would allow me to set the date/time but returned to erratic operation again. Is it worth having this camera repaired or is it toast.
